ALEXANDRIA, Va., Aug. 12 -- United States Patent no. 12,386,724, issued on Aug. 12, was assigned to ROBERT BOSCH GMBH (Stuttgart, Germany).

"Method for assessing a software for a control unit of a vehicle" was invented by Dora Wilmes (Stuttgart, Germany), Marina Ullmann (Gerlingen, Germany) and Matthias Birk (Heimsheim, Germany).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A method for assessing a software for a control unit of a vehicle. The control unit includes a memory storing first and second versions of the software, and a processor.
